WebFull Title The Most Excellent and Lamentable Tragedy of Romeo and Juliet. Author William Shakespeare. Type of work Play. Genre Tragic drama. Language English. Time and place written London, mid-1590s. Definitions [ edit] WebJul 31, 2015 · Synopsis: A street fight breaks out between the Montagues and the Capulets, which is broken up by the ruler of Verona, Prince Escalus. He threatens the Montagues and Capulets with death if they fight again. A melancholy Romeo enters and is questioned by his cousin Benvolio, who learns that the cause of Romeo’s sadness is unrequited love.

WebJuliet Capulet ( Italian: Giulietta Capuleti) is the female protagonist in William Shakespeare 's romantic tragedy Romeo and Juliet. A 13-year-old girl, Juliet is the only daughter of the patriarch of the House of Capulet. WebRomeo and Juliet, play by William Shakespeare, written about 1594–96 and first published in an unauthorized quarto in 1597. An authorized quarto appeared in 1599, substantially longer and more reliable.
